&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;Debdaru&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;  local name for a tall, attractive, bushy evergreen tree, Polyalthia longifolia of the family Annonaceae with smooth, dark bark and undulate leaves. Flowers are yellowish-green and normally arranged in clusters. Debdaru is a native of Sri Lanka and as an exotic tree species it has been planted in Bangladesh. The wood is white or whitish-yellow, light, very flexible, fairly close and even-grained. The wood is used for various purposes including making drums, pencils, small boxes and matches. Bark of this tree contains medicinal properties, which is used as a febrifuge.  [Md. Mahfuzur Rahman] &lt;br /&gt;
